Output 87ab31b08de5126aca47d39ecfde8f3d23ab825a44888fb7b62f47b428d0b5d6:0

value
5866366
script pubkey
OP_0 OP_PUSHBYTES_20 50c13014c0a757a889c4ce2ecb19e0b9b9b53287
address
bc1q2rqnq9xq5at63zwyechvkx0qhxum2v58gk9g77
transaction
87ab31b08de5126aca47d39ecfde8f3d23ab825a44888fb7b62f47b428d0b5d6
spent
true